John Steffens maintains a civil trial practice dedicated to helping clients navigate complex disputes. Mr. Steffens believes it is important to thoroughly investigate cases and works hard along with his clients to achieve the best result possible. Mr. Steffens is an experienced trial attorney, having successfully represented clients in numerous trials before state courts, federal courts and arbitration panels. In addition, Mr. Steffens has developed a successful appellate practice in which he represents both his own clients and clients referred by other attorneys for appellate purposes. Mr. Steffens has briefed and argued numerous appeals in both state and federal courts. In 2021, the Missouri Bar Foundation chose Mr. Steffens for the David J. Dixon Appellate Advocacy Award, which identifies and acknowledges Missouri lawyers under 40 that excel in advocacy skills as observed by appellate judges.
